Oracle RAC(Real Applicaio Clusers)多节点配置指南
1. Oracle RAC简介
Oracle RAC,全称Real Applicaio Clusers,是Oracle提供的一种高可用性、高可扩展性的解决方案。它允许在多台服务器上运行多个Oracle数据库实例,并共享相同的存储资源。RAC的主要目标是提供高可用性、负载均衡和容错能力,确保在任何节点故障时,应用程序仍可继续运行。
2. RAC节点硬件配置
为了支持RAC环境,每个节点都需要满足一定的硬件要求。这包括足够的CPU、内存和存储资源。建议使用高性能的处理器、足够的RAM和高速的存储设备。为了确保RAC的稳定性和性能,建议使用具有冗余电源和冷却系统的硬件设备。
3. RAC节点网络配置
RAC环境中的每个节点都需要配置网络连接。节点之间需要建立高速、稳定的网络连接,以便进行数据通信和同步。还需要配置网络设备,如交换机、路由器等,以确保网络的稳定性和性能。
4. RAC节点存储配置
RAC环境中的所有节点共享相同的存储资源。这包括磁盘、文件系统和数据库文件。为了确保数据的完整性和一致性,建议使用高性能的存储设备,并配置RAID以增加数据保护和性能。
5. RAC节点数据库配置
在RAC环境中,每个节点都需要配置一个Oracle数据库实例。这包括安装Oracle数据库软件、创建数据库实例、配置数据库参数等。为了确保RAC的稳定性和性能,建议使用Oracle提供的最佳实践和配置指南来配置数据库。
6. RAC节点资源管理
7. RAC节点监控与调优
为了确保RAC环境的稳定性和性能,需要对每个节点进行监控和调优。这包括监控CPU、内存、磁盘等资源的使用情况,以及监控数据库的性能指标。根据监控结果,可以对配置进行调整和优化,以提高性能和稳定性。
下一篇:像充电宝一样的u盘叫啥